Default AC Problem

92 C4-Changed out the condensor in winter. Charged & ran. All was well. Ran it just last week & found out that their is air/liquid coming out of the check valve on top of the compressor. What is the problem here, anyone?

That's the High Pressure Relief Valve which is set to blow somewhere around 450 to 600 psi. There is also a high pressure shutoff which is from the Presssure Sensor on the High Pressure Line. Should the PCM see 400 psi (about 4 volts) from that Sensor, it opens the Compressor Relay shutting off the Compressor. Assuming yours continued to run (and made cold air), the pressure is probably within specs and you simply need a new Relief Valve. Unfortunately, you'll have to discharge it to replace it and to be sure there's nothing else going on, you should hook up a Manifold Gage Set and check operating pressures.
